The Ardleigh mantel clock, boxed for transit to Quillon Horology, was not collected during yesterday's scheduled window. The crate is padded, labelled fragile, and currently stored in the front office cupboard. The repair slot is held until Friday, so a replacement pick-up has been arranged for tomorrow between 10:00 and 12:00. Please ensure someone is present to release the crate and witness the condition note. The confidential courier hand-over instruction follows immediately below.

handover note for yagef-bagep: the drudor pelius courier leaves the kasdor zorvan norir ledger at gate 8016 under passcode 755406

# Liftwise elevator-dispatch simulator — env config.
# Discussed at the weekly eng sync: SIM_CAR_COUNT and
# SIM_FLOOR_COUNT drive scenario size; keep them matched
# to the benchmark suite before comparing dispatch latency.
# The simulator reports results to the shared dashboard,
# which requires an auth credential set on the next line.

vault entry, yahif-yajep: COURIER_KEY29=b802bdf8034096b65a51c6ba5abe2

# Build Provenance: Export Service

Welcome aboard! If you're poking at the Tallgrass spreadsheet export service, know that its memory profile is provenance-tracked: every build records the allocator settings and streaming flags used at compile time, because a past regression quietly doubled heap usage for big exports. So before you blame the runtime, check what the build actually shipped with. The provenance record lives alongside the artifact, and each entry is keyed by the short build token shown right below this paragraph.

trace token, kawip-fafog: htk14_26e64c4d35154e

**14:22 — Donation receipts go sideways.** The GivingLoop mailer at Harborfern started sending duplicate receipts after the retry queue got stuck in a loop. Support saw about 40 tickets before Priya paused the worker. Dedupe patch shipped at 15:05 and backfill finished clean. If a donor asks which fix they're on, reference the build token below.

pipeline stamp: htk9_ce63042d9